Brighton v Saints

Saints make the short trip to Brighton looking to build on their win over Cardiff last week.

Both teams go into the game on the back of good victories; The Seagulls beat Millwall 2-0 in their last game.

Brighton Team News:

Brighton are boosted by the return of Alex Frutos, while Gary hart is also expected to figure despite picking up a facial injury in the win over Millwall.

Player to watch: Alex Frutos

Saints Team News:

Danny Higginbotham will be missing with both a broken wrist and leg injury, he'll be out for around two weeks. Darren Powell should be fit to replace him in defence.

Darren Kenton is also sideliend with a hamstring injury and Matt Oakley hasn't recovered from his ankle injury.

Alexander Ostlund and Nathan Dyer are both set to return for Saints.

Player to watch: Ricardo Fuller

Fuller is likely to keep his place up front after scoring twice on his surprise return to Saints in the 3-2 win over Cardiff last week.
